Comparison of uterine fibroids' growth pattern during pregnancy according to fetal sex: an observational study.

Women with female fetus seem to have a higher growth of fibroids up to second trimester of pregnancy. This process may be mediated by the higher serum hCG levels found in women expecting a female fetus.
